Create a Form

Fluent Forms is a drag-and-drop WordPress form builder. You can create contact forms, surveys, payment forms, and more without writing code.

This guide walks you through building a form from scratch—adding fields, customizing settings, saving your work, and embedding the form on your site. New to the plugin? See Getting Started With Fluent Forms and the Fluent Forms User Interface overview first.

Creating a New Form

To start, log in to your WordPress Dashboard. Now, navigate to the Fluent Forms > Forms from the left sidebar. Then click on the + Add New Form button in the Forms Section.

Add new form

A popup will appear, and you will have some options to create a form. These are:

  • New Blank Form: Creating a blank form allows you to build a form from scratch.
  • Choose a Template: This option allows you to choose a pre-made template for your website, divided into different categories, to avoid the hassle of building form from scratch. To use the premium templates, you need to install & activate the Fluent Forms Pro Add-on.
  • Conversational Forms: This allows you to transform content or surveys into interactive conversations.
  • Create Using AI: This option allows you to create a form with AI.

You can also import ready-made forms by clicking the Import Form button. See How to Import and Export Fluent Forms for details. For example, here I created a Blank From from scratch to show you the whole process of creating a new form.

First, click the Plus Icon to create a new blank form.

Adding Fields

Here comes the Editor page. Now, click the Pencil Icon in the left corner to edit your form name.

To add the desired fields, either click the Plus Icon or open the Fields Sections by clicking the Dropdown Arrow under the Input Fields tab.

You can also search for the desired fields by their name using the Search Bar.

Once you click the Pencil/Edit Icon, a new pop-up will appear to set the form title. Now, type the desired Title Text and click the Rename button to set Form Names.

Rename form

Now add fields according to your requirements by clicking the desired Field buttons or just Drag and Drop them into the Editor. To learn more about adding fields, see the Form Fields overview.

Customizing Form

Now, to customize the Fields, hover over the desired field and click the Pencil/Edit Icon.

It will redirect you to the Input Customization tab on the right sidebar, which offers a wide range of customization possibilities, from renaming a field to setting the maximum size of a file input field.

Form edit history

Open the History tab in the Form Builder to view recent changes to your form.

  • Restore: Revert the form to a previous saved state.
  • Delete: Remove a history entry you no longer need.

Embedding Form into Frontend

After customization, click the Save Form button in the top right corner to save all the changes. Also, click the Preview & Design button in the middle if you want to see the preview of your form.

Then, copy the Form ShortCode from the top bar to display it on the front end.

Save and shortcode

Paste the shortcode in your desired Page/Post where you want this shortcode to appear on your WordPress Site.
